| 49 | /** Match a rule, or the empty string | |
| 50 | ||
| 51 | Optional BNF elements are denoted with | |
| 52 | square brackets. If the specified rule | |
| 53 | returns any error it is treated as if | |
| 54 | the rule did not match. | |
| 55 | ||
| 56 | @par Value Type | |
| 57 | @code | |
| 58 | using value_type = optional< typename Rule::value_type >; | |
| 59 | @endcode | |
| 60 | ||
| 61 | @par Example | |
| 62 | Rules are used with the function @ref grammar::parse. | |
| 63 | @code | |
| 64 | system::result< optional< core::string_view > > rv = parse( "", optional_rule( token_rule( alpha_chars ) ) ); | |
| 65 | @endcode | |
| 66 | ||
| 67 | @par BNF | |
| 68 | @code | |
| 69 | optional = [ rule ] | |
| 70 | @endcode | |
| 71 | ||
| 72 | @par Specification | |
| 73 | @li <a href="https://datatracker.ietf.org/doc/html/rfc5234#section-3.8" | |
| 74 | >3.8. Optional Sequence (rfc5234)</a> | |
| 75 | ||
| 76 | @param r The rule to match | |
| 77 | @return The adapted rule | |
| 78 | ||
| 79 | @see | |
| 80 | @ref alpha_chars, | |
| 81 | @ref parse, | |
| 82 | @ref optional, | |
| 83 | @ref token_rule. | |
| 84 | */ | |
